Rapper Jahi Releases New Book, “The Intersection Between Hip Hop Culture & Education: The Museum Experiences”
0
SHARES
0
VIEWS
Share ShareShareShareShareShare

Oakland, CA — Jahi, an MC, educator, and part of the Public Enemy family (Enemy Radio), fresh off his performance opening the BET Awards with a 2020 version of “Fight The Power” with Chuck D, Flavor Flav, DJ Lord, the S1W’s, Nas, Rapsody, Black Thought, YG, and Questlove announces his book, The Intersection between Hip Hop Culture & Education on Enemy Books.

The book shares a narrative of how Jahi traveled to 20 museums around the world presenting Hip Hop as a world culture with life affirming principles. The book is now available in e-book and physical format everywhere you purchase books.
